> I am fairly new to RPM so I was hoping someone might be able to help me
> with my issue.  
> 
> Previously I had two RPMs lets say A.rpm and B.rpm, I have recently
> moved all components & functionality from B.rpm into A.rpm.  My problem
> occurs when attempting to upgrade from my previous installed RPM package
> to my new one single rpm.  RPM complains that some of the components of
> A.rpm conflict with files from package B.rpm.  Is there any way to
> remove package B.rpm from with my new RPM before the conflict occurs?
> Or is there any way to get around this issue from within my new A.rpm?
> 

On your new A, add an "Obsoletes" tag:
Obsoletes: B
